Title: Innovations and Contributions of Stewart Frederick Bryant
Introduction: Stewart Frederick Bryant, based in Merstham, GB, has made significant contributions to the field of networking technology, as evidenced by his impressive portfolio of 72 patents. His work focuses primarily on advancements in multiprotocol label switching (MPLS) networks, showcasing his role as a pioneering inventor in this area.
Latest Patents: Bryant's latest patents illustrate his innovative approach to enhancing network services. One notable patent, titled "MPLS Extension Headers for In-Network Services," outlines methods for routers to add in-network services to MPLS networks. The invention includes techniques for modifying packets by appending MPLS extension headers and indicating their presence within an MPLS label stack. Another significant patent is "Segment Routing in MPLS Network," which describes methods for performing segment routing over MPLS networks. This includes the use of segment routing headers that provide segment identifiers for efficient packet forwarding.
Career Highlights: Throughout his career, Stewart Frederick Bryant has been affiliated with leading technology companies such as Cisco Technology, Inc. and Huawei Technologies Co., Limited. His work at these organizations has substantially influenced the development of routing technologies, particularly in the realm of MPLS networks.
